国产一区二区精品-国产一区二区精品久-国产一区二区精品久久-国产一区二区精品久久91-免费毛片播放-免费毛片基地

千鋒教育-做有情懷、有良心、有品質的職業教育機構

手機站
千鋒教育

千鋒學習站 | 隨時隨地免費學

千鋒教育

掃一掃進入千鋒手機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地免費學習課程

當前位置:首頁  >  千鋒問問  > java多態是什么

java多態是什么

java多態是什么 匿名提問者 2023-07-28 17:36:30

java多態是什么

我要提問

推薦答案

  Java多態是面向對象編程中的重要概念,它允許一個對象在不同情況下表現出不同的行為。在這篇文章中,我們將深入探討Java多態的原理和實現方式。

千鋒教育

  首先,我們會解釋什么是多態,以及它在Java中的具體體現。我們會介紹Java中的兩種實現多態的方式:方法重寫(Override)和方法重載(Overload)。通過代碼示例,幫助讀者理解多態在Java中的應用場景。

  接著,我們會探討多態的底層原理,包括虛方法表(Vtable)和動態綁定(Dynamic Binding)。我們將解釋Java是如何在運行時確定方法調用的實際實現,從而實現多態性的。

  然后,我們會介紹多態對于代碼設計和可擴展性的重要性。通過多態,我們可以編寫更加靈活和可復用的代碼,減少代碼的重復性,提高代碼的可維護性。

  最后,我們會總結Java多態的優缺點,以及使用多態時需要注意的一些注意事項。通過閱讀這篇文章,讀者將深入理解Java多態的概念和原理,從而在實際項目中更好地應用多態特性。

其他答案

  •   Java多態是面向對象編程的核心概念之一,它可以讓我們以一種更加靈活和可擴展的方式編寫代碼。在這篇文章中,我們將通過實例解析,展示Java多態在實際項目中的應用。

      我們會從簡單的代碼示例開始,介紹Java中多態的基本用法:通過父類引用指向子類對象。然后,我們會展示多態如何讓代碼更加靈活和可復用,通過實例解析多態對于代碼設計的積極影響。

      接著,我們會通過一個實際的應用場景,如圖形繪制程序,來演示多態在實際項目中的運用。我們會展示如何利用多態特性,簡化代碼邏輯,提高程序的可擴展性。

      然后,我們會介紹Java中多態的實現方式:方法重寫(Override)和接口實現。我們會解釋它們的區別和適用場景,幫助讀者更好地理解多態的不同表現形式。

      最后,我們會總結Java多態的優勢和適用范圍,幫助讀者在日后的項目中更加自如地使用多態特性,編寫出更加靈活和可維護的代碼。

  •   Java多態性是面向對象編程中的重要特性,它為代碼設計和開發帶來了很多優勢。在這篇文章中,我們將探討Java多態性的魅力和優勢。

      我們會首先介紹什么是多態性,以及它在面向對象編程中的作用。我們會解釋多態性如何讓代碼更加靈活和可擴展,以及如何提高代碼的可讀性和可維護性。

      然后,我們會通過一系列實例,展示多態性在Java中的具體應用。我們會介紹使用父類引用指向子類對象的方式,以及如何在運行時動態地確定方法的實際調用。

      接著,我們會探討多態性在代碼設計中的重要性。通過多態性,我們可以編寫更加通用和靈活的代碼,減少代碼的冗余,提高代碼的可復用性。

      最后,我們會討論多態性的一些注意事項和局限性。雖然多態性帶來了很多優勢,但在使用時也需要注意一些細節,以避免潛在的問題。

      通過閱讀這篇文章,讀者將深入了解Java多態性的魅力和優勢,從而在面向對象編程中更加熟練地運用多態性特性。